- Global BAD_RETURN (cmd)
- put this define in types.h or similar. Certain functions are marked as having return values, but do not actually return a value. This causes undefined behavior, which we'd rather avoid on modern GCC. This only impacts -O2 and can matter for both the function itself and functions that call it.
